Across the reviewers we read, Midtown earns the warmest brand-level praise of any umbrella maker in this group. An r/homeowners commenter who owns multiple Midtown umbrellas calls them 'beautiful, very well made,' and reports incredible customer service, while r/diynz owners of comparable premium umbrellas describe canopies that 'still look like new' after seven-plus years. This 9-foot model pairs that reputation with heavy-duty Terylast polyester (a heavy-duty fabric the maker markets for harsh weather), a metal auto-tilt and crank, and a 10-year no-fade promise, at a mid-tier price around $142.
The consensus framing is that you're paying for fabric longevity and a no-plastic mechanism rather than raw size. Amazon feedback (4.5 over roughly 786) is solid if far smaller than the budget market leaders. Buyers should weigh that the strongest endorsements are brand-level community sentiment rather than a high-trust lab test of this specific SKU, and r/homeowners still stresses that even a well-built umbrella needs a heavy base to survive wind.
